Get Social Insurance, PPSU Demanded to Boost Their Performance

Starting this November 2015, as many as 3,123 Infrastructure and Public Facility Handling Officers (PPSU) in 65 urban villages in East Jakarta have been insured in the Healthcare and Social Security Agency (BPJS Kesehatan) and Workers Social Security Agency (BPJS Ketenagakerjaan).

This is due to the signing of a cooperation agreement PPSU worker participation between BPJS Ketenagakerjaan and Health BPJS with Urban Village Heads in East Jakarta at Ruang Pola of East Jakarta Mayor Office, Wednesday (10/28).

“PPSU officer gets work accident assurance and death for BPJS Ketenagakerjaan while health assurance for BPJS health program,” said East Jakarta Vice Mayor, Husesin Murad.

Meanwhile, Head of Governance for East Jakarta Administration, Manson Sinaga hoped the work performance of PPSU worker could increase through this assurance.

“By the expectation, they have more spirit to run their duty in respective urban villages,” he finished.
